Binli Xiao is a scholar working on Materials Chemistry, Biomedical Engineering and Electrical and Electronic Engineering. According to data from OpenAlex, Binli Xiao has authored 13 papers receiving a total of 250 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Materials Chemistry, 6 papers in Biomedical Engineering and 4 papers in Electrical and Electronic Engineering. Recurrent topics in Binli Xiao’s work include Luminescence Properties of Advanced Materials (11 papers), Luminescence and Fluorescent Materials (9 papers) and Nanoplatforms for cancer theranostics (3 papers). Binli Xiao is often cited by papers focused on Luminescence Properties of Advanced Materials (11 papers), Luminescence and Fluorescent Materials (9 papers) and Nanoplatforms for cancer theranostics (3 papers). Binli Xiao collaborates with scholars based in China and Hong Kong. Binli Xiao's co-authors include Sheng Wu, Puxian Xiong, Yinzhen Wang, Yao Xiao, Peishan Shao, Yan Chen, Kang Chen, Feifei Wang, Zhi-Gang Shao and Quan Liu and has published in prestigious journals such as Advanced Materials, Chemical Engineering Journal and Small.
